    Notes: Abstract: The consequences of the gauge constraints for off-shellness in the electromagnetic (EM) vertices have been considered, using Compton scattering as an example. We have found that even if the gauge constraint for the 3-point EM Green function allows for off-shell effects in the charge (Dirac) form factor, they vanish in the total Compton scattering amplitude due to the gauge constraint for the 4-point EM Green function only. In addition, the representations of the Compton amplitude in terms of either reducible or irreducible vertices are equivalent for conserved currents.
